我有一块金士顿 V200 256GB SSD。当连接到主板上的 SATA 6.0gbps 端口时,我看到连续读取速度为 300 兆字节/秒。
当我将驱动器放入 SATA 转 USB 3.0 外壳并将其连接到我的 USB 3.0 主板端口时,我的连续读取速度最高为 200 兆字节/秒,平均为 120 兆字节/秒。我在另一台机器上试用了该外壳,同样获得了 120 兆字节/秒。
我猜是机箱本身造成了瓶颈。有谁知道机箱芯片组本身的评论/基准测试,这样我就可以买一些不会拖慢我速度的东西吗?
答案1
USB 比 SATA 慢。新的 SATA 3 标准理论上的最大速度为 6.0 Gbps,而 USB 3 理论上的最大双向速度为 4.8 Gbps。如果我们计算一下这些数字...
USB 3.0 SATA 3 4800Mbps 单向 6000Mbps 单程 600 MBps 750 MBps USB 2.0 SATA 2 480Mbps除以2,单程3000Mbps 240Mbps 或 30MBps 单程 375 MBps
编辑:正如@MrAlpha 所说,我坚持 USB 3 的正确性;它可以利用全双工(如所述这里)
答案2
http://electronicdesign.com/article/embedded/whats-difference-usb-uasp-bot-73593
该外壳缺乏更快的 UASP 模式。USB 3.0 的实际吞吐量最大为 400MB/秒(USB 3.0 在最佳情况下的开销为 36%)。
典型的 USB 3.0 设备似乎仅启用 BOTS,将其限制为最大 250MB/秒,尽管在我看来这似乎是一个速度较慢的驱动器外壳。
在现实世界中,eSata 3.0gbps 的平均速度仍比 USB 3.0 快 300MB/秒。令人失望。